DKSH has been rated as one of the 50 most trustworthy companies in Western Europe by US business magazine Forbes. Among the 1,400 European-based companies considered, six Swiss corporations including DKSH made it to the top ranks.

Zurich, Switzerland, June 9, 2017 – As the leading Market Expansion Services provider with a focus on Asia, trust is at the very core of DKSH's business model. Leading international clients choose DKSH as a trustworthy and professional partner to outsource their marketing and sales activities in Asia and to help them to grow in the long-term and gain market shares.
The renowned US business magazine now has identified DKSH as one of Western Europe's 50 most trustworthy companies. Of the top 50, 24 firms call the United Kingdom home, seven are from Germany and six are from Switzerland.
Each year, Forbes evaluates 1,400 European-based companies based on accounting and governance practices. For this purpose, Forbes refers to the AGR (Accounting and Governance Risk) Score, a rating published by the New York-based investment decision provider MSCI, which helps investors and other business partners to identify risks and opportunities.
AGR assesses companies considering their risk management, revenue and expense recognition, asset and liability valuation as well as corporate governance. Companies with a high valuation are considered particularly trustworthy. DKSH for the past four quarters achieved an average AGR score of 88 out of 100.

About DKSH Group
DKSH is the leading Market Expansion Services provider with a focus on Asia. As the term "Market Expansion Services" suggests, DKSH helps other companies and brands to grow their business in new or existing markets. Publicly listed on the SIX Swiss Exchange since 2012, DKSH is a global company headquartered in Zurich. With 780 business locations in 36 countries – 750 of them in Asia – and 30,320 specialized staff, DKSH generated net sales of CHF 10.5 billion in 2016. DKSH was founded in 1865. With strong Swiss heritage, the company has a long tradition of doing business in and with Asia and is deeply rooted in communities and businesses across Asia Pacific.
